Historical Events
- 1590 Battle of Ivry: French King Henry IV beats Catholic League during French Wars of Religion
- 1794 Eli Whitney patents the cotton gin machine revolutionizing the cotton industry in the southern US states
- 1900 Dutch botanist Hugo de Vries rediscovers Gregor Mendel's laws of heredity and genetics
- 1900 US currency goes on gold standard after Congress passes the Currency Act
- 1943 World War II: Kraków Ghetto is "liquidated"
- 2013 Xi Jinping named the new President of the People's Republic of China
